“Wondering if there are fresh sheets on the mattress in your hotel room? Look for crease lines. Hotels always tightly fold up their sheets after they’ve cleaned them. If there are creases, they’re fresh.”

“Flight get canceled? Instead of rushing the ticket agent with the rest of the travelers, call the airline’s 1-800 number. They can do the exact same stuff as the agent can, and you’ll beat 90 percent of the line by doing so.”

“Take a quick photo of yourself with your luggage before leaving for the airport. In the unfortunate event that your luggage gets lost, the photo helps the airline track it down and proves that you own it.”

“The “skiplagged” method helps you get to your destination cheaper as the layover, and not the final destination. For example, a New York to Orlando flight is $250, but a flight from New York to Austin with a layover in Orlando is $150. You can search for these deals at Skiplagged.”
